'Taste of Plants' is this intriguing documentary that takes you straight to the heart of the mountains. It really dives into the relationship between humans and mountain flora, exploring not just what's edible but also the cultural significance behind these plants. The pacing feels natural, almost like a leisurely hike through the Alps or Pyrenees, where you come across passionate naturalists who share their knowledge. There's a certain urgency in their voices, especially when discussing the impact of human activity on these ecosystems. The visuals are striking, capturing the beauty of these plants and landscapes. It's a blend of nature's bounty and a sobering reminder of our responsibility, making it distinctive in the realm of nature documentaries.
